RIVERDALE — An Ogden man died when he lost control of his SUV on I-15 in Riverdale Wednesday morning. Investigators believe fatigue may have been a factor.

Ogden resident Maurice Charlston, 56, was traveling north at 5:38 a.m. when his Ford Explorer veered to the right, according to a statement from the Utah Highway Patrol.

Charlston then over-corrected and his vehicle rolled four to five times, landing on an embankment north of Riverdale Road.

Charlston was wearing a seat belt, the UHP reported, but he died at the scene.

UHP reported four additional crashes as a result of other drivers not paying attention to the road but instead watching the fatal crash scene.
